- Planning object structure '&1' (client '&2' deleted in target system ?The SAP error message
/SAPAPO/TSM464
indicates that a planning object structure has been deleted in the target system. This error typically arises in the context of SAP Advanced Planning and Optimization (APO) when there is an inconsistency between the source and target systems, particularly during data transfer or system migration processes.Cause:
- Deleted Planning Object Structure: The planning object structure specified in the error message has been deleted in the target system. This could happen due to manual deletions, system migrations, or changes in configuration.
- Transport Issues: If the planning object structure was supposed to be transported from one system to another and the transport request was not executed properly, it could lead to this error.
- Configuration Changes: Changes in the configuration of the APO system that were not properly synchronized between systems can also lead to this error.
Solution:
- Check Planning Object Structure: Verify if the planning object structure
&1
exists in the target system. You can do this by navigating to the relevant transaction in SAP APO (e.g.,/SAPAPO/TSM
).- Recreate or Restore: If the planning object structure has been deleted, you may need to recreate it or restore it from a backup if available.
- Transport Request: If the planning object structure was supposed to be transported, ensure that the transport request containing the planning object structure is correctly released and imported into the target system.
- Consistency Check: Perform a consistency check between the source and target systems to identify any other discrepancies that may exist.
- Consult Documentation: Review SAP documentation or notes related to the specific planning object structure for any additional steps or considerations.
